Asturian
Alternative forms
Etymology
From Late Latin lactem, from Latin lac. Compare Leonese lleite, Mirandese lheite, Spanish leche, as well as dialectal Leonese tsechi and Extremaduran llechi.
Pronunciation
Noun
lleche m or f (uncountable)
- milk
- Ta frío la lleche
- the milk is cold
- Cola lleche fáise quesu y mantiega
- Cheese and butter are made with milk
